Insulating film
Before you attempt to install insulation film for double-glazing windows first check that your windows double glazing are in good condition. Get rid of any oil or grease residue and clean the frame with a washing up liquid solution. Then, carefully cut out the film. Be sure to put your inside fold against the window. After you've cut your film to the right size, it's time to install it.
When you install the insulating film it is essential to first prepare your window frame and all associated components. Clean the frames thoroughly and ensure they're free of grease. All hinges, latches and knobs must be secured. Attaching latches as well as other fittings using blue tack is a good idea. These materials create a smooth surface that seals. After that, you can use the film for repairs to windows that need a repair.
Window insulation film is another alternative. This thin layer of plastic sticks to the glass and can be used to insulate windows. This film blocks the transfer of heat to the building, which in turn assists in reducing heating costs and conserve the heat in the summer. The film is simple to install and fairly affordable. It also includes solar control capabilities. It reduces heat by reflecting the infrared portion of solar energy, and also blocking UV radiation. Most films can last for a decade or longer. They adhere directly to glass which makes installation quick and painless.
Window film is an affordable alternative to double glazing. These kits are simple to install and the film provides an additional layer of insulation to the glass. Another benefit of window film is its easy removal, making it a great choice for rental properties. Unlike double-glazing, it's also cost-effective and easy to remove. It is also simple to remove and does not require a skilled professional to complete the task.

Warm edge spacer bars
Warm edge bars for double-glazed windows are a popular choice for a variety of uses. These innovative products can increase the thermal efficiency of double glazed windows and lower the U-factor overall by up to four degrees. These are especially beneficial for double-glazed windows with lower-quality glazing, such as double-glazed insulation glass. Additionally, warm edge spacers bars help protect the glass unit from external elements such as wind and water.
There are two main types which are polypropylene or stainless steel. Stainless steel has lower conductivity at temperatures than polypropylene. It is also resistant to corrosion, and is resistant to condensation. Some warm edge spacers also are made of plastic. They are typically made from polycarbonate and polypropylene. Silicone-based materials are also utilized to develop flexible warm edge spacers.
A spacer bar with a warm edge helps to reduce the effect of thermal bridges at the window. This can lead to significant energy savings and also a boost in the air quality of the room. The benefits of using warm edge spacers in double-glazing windows are substantial. They also help to reduce energy loss and offer a great level of comfort for the people who live there. With so many advantages warm edge spacer bars are a fantastic option for a range of projects.
Warm edge bars for double glazing near me-glazed windows are a great way to improve the efficiency of thermal insulation in sealed units. They stop heat from flowing through the spacer. The warm edge spacer bar is a cheap and effective solution to the issue. They're a beautiful and cost-effective way to lower your heating bills and save money. You'll be amazed by the difference a warm edge spacer bar can make.
